di·a·crit·ic /ˌdaɪəˈkrɪtɪk/ noun [countable] technical  SLAa mark placed over, under, or through a letter in some languages, to show that the letter should be pronounced differently from the same letter without a mark 变音符,附加符号〔置于字母上下方或横贯字母的符号,表示该字母与无此符号的字母发音不同〕diacritical adjective diacritical marks 变音符号
Origin diacritic (1600-1700) Greek diakritikos, from krinein to separate
